Health Issues

With a little attention, Frenchies can lead long, healthy lives. Like all breeds they are susceptible to health problems. If you are thinking of buying a French Bulldog make sure you work with a breeder that is focused on their dogs' health. Find a breeder who tests their dogs for genetic disorders and health issues, and also offers a health warranty for their pups.

Because of their facial structure, Frenchies are prone to brachycephalic obstruction of the airway or BOAS. This condition makes it more difficult for them to breathe, particularly in hot weather. To help avoid BOAS ensure that your dog is away from the heat and avoid overworking them.

Frenchies are more prone to corneal ulcers due their large eyes. Intervertebral disk disease is a different spinal condition that Frenchies are susceptible to. This occurs when the jelly-like cushion that lies between each vertebrae ruptures or slips, pressing against the spinal cord. Allergies are a common problem for Frenchies This is not a surprise considering the number of people who bring them into the world. Symptoms include itchy paws and skin folds. To prevent allergies be sure to keep your French Bulldog far away from pollen, dust and other triggers. Apply gentle shampoo on his body.

In addition, due to their shorter legs, Frenchies are at risk for back problems. Hip dysplasia is a degenerative joint problem which can be treated with medication and physiotherapy. In more severe cases surgery may be needed. It is also recommended to stretch your Frenchie often to prevent him from overexerting.
